The CFPB says colleges are inappropriately steering students toward banks and credit card companies that charge high overdraft fees, inactivity penalties, and big ATM charges. Nearly half a million college students paid a combined $12.5 million in fees last year,. usually because they had a low bank balance. A Wall Street Journal investigation found that these deals make a lot of money for the colleges, but it leaves the students with big banking fees.
